Toyota Issues Recall of 600,000 Sienna Minivans to Fix Corrosion Issue

Toyota has issued a recall of approximately 600,000 first and second generation Sienna minivans (1998-2010) to address potential corrosion in the spare tire carrier cable. The voluntary recall affects Siennas that have been operated in cold climate areas with high road salt use. 2011 BMW 528i Starts at $45,425

BMW has announced the pricing for the all-new 2011 BMW 528i which starts at $45,425. The 2011 528i joins the 535i ($50,475) and 550i ($60,575) in July. The 2011 528i is powered by a 240-hp 3.0L six-cylinder mated to an eight-speed automatic transmission. 2011 Audi A8 L Debuts with 500HP W12 Engine

Audi has unveiled the extended-wheelbase version of the new 2011 Audi A8. The flagship model in the A8 lineup, the A8 L W12 quattro is powered by a 500-hp 6.3L 12-cylinder engine.
